Join us for a UVic School of Music faculty concert celebrating the rich colours and expressive possibilities of chamber music.

The evening features Beethoven’s Trio for trumpet, horn, and trombone, performed by Merrie Klazek, Sam McNally, and Graham Middleton (Principal Trombone, Victoria Symphony). This rarely heard early work highlights the playful dialogue and bold resonance of the brass family. The program continues with Max Bruch’s Eight Pieces, Op. 83 — a collection of lyrical and warmly romantic miniatures. Performed by Pam Highbaugh Aloni, Michelle Feng, and Arthur Rowe, these pieces offer intimate moods and beautifully intertwined lines. Also on the concert is Francis Poulenc’s charming Trio for oboe, bassoon, and piano. At once elegant, witty, and deeply expressive, the trio showcases the unique character of each instrument. Featured in this performance are Katrina Russell (bassoon), Michelle Feng (oboe), and Arthur Rowe (piano).
